Notes

Rachio 3 is a smart sprinkler controller used by homeowners who want app control, weather adjustments, and fewer wasted watering cycles. "Solenoid terminal corrosion" is a common field problem because controllers live in garages, basements, or outdoor enclosures where humidity and fertilizer dust can accelerate oxidation.

Repair is usually practical: clean or replace the terminal block, trim and re-terminate wires, add drip loops, and confirm the enclosure seals properly. It's also wise to check for surge damage after storms, since irrigation wiring can act like an antenna.

Repair makes sense when zone outputs still function and the controller's Wi-Fi/app behavior is stable. Replace becomes more rational if multiple zones intermittently fail (relay/triac wear), the power supply is unstable, or corrosion has spread onto the main board.

Given the relatively low replacement cost, once repair time and parts approach the threshold, replacing the controller is often the simpler reliability move.
